Understanding Bunk Beds with Trundle
A bunk bed with a trundle includes a traditional bunk bed style with an additional mattress stored beneath the lower bunk. Bunk Beds With Trundle can be taken out quickly, providing an additional sleeping space when required. This dual performance makes bunk beds with trundles an attractive choice for numerous living scenarios, from children's spaces to villa.
Secret Features of Bunk Beds with Trundle
Space Efficiency: Bunk beds are designed to make the most of vertical space, making them perfect for smaller sized rooms.
Additional Sleeping Space: The presence of the trundle indicates that a single bunk bed can accommodate three individuals, making it ideal for slumber parties or accommodating guests.
Versatility: Many bunk bed designs feature functions like built-in storage, desks, and racks, even more boosting their performance.
Range of Designs and Materials: Bunk beds with trundles are offered in various designs, colors, and products, enabling you to pick one that fits your decor and style choices.
Safety Features: Many modern models come with safety features like guardrails, sturdy ladders, and low profiles to protect versus mishaps.

Factors To Consider When Buying Bunk Beds with Trundle
While bunk beds with trundles offer a number of advantages, there are a couple of aspects to think about before purchasing:
Safety Standards
- Examine Compliance: Ensure that the bed complies with national security requirements to protect kids.
- Weight Capacity: Assess the weight limitations of both the leading bunk and the trundle to prevent accidents.
Space Dimensions
- Space Measurement: Measure your room to make sure the bunk bed will fit conveniently, enabling sufficient space for motion.
Bed mattress Size
- Size Compatibility: Ensure you purchase the right mattress size to fit both the upper bunk and the trundle.
Product Quality
- Toughness and Stability: Choose bunk beds made from top quality materials that can withstand rough usage over time.
Style Preferences
- Design Choices: Consider the aesthetics of the bed to make certain it complements the existing décor.
Relieve of Assembly
- Assembly Complexity: Consider how easy or difficult the bed will be to assemble, especially if moving it to a various area later on.
Maintenance
- Cleaning up and Care: Look for beds that are easy to tidy, as kids can be unpleasant!

FAQs About Bunk Beds with Trundle
1. Are bunk beds with trundle safe for kids?
Yes, as long as they are made according to safety requirements and consist of functions like guardrails and sturdy construction.
2. Can trundle beds be used as regular beds?
Absolutely! Wood Bunk Beds With Trundle UK can be utilized for daily sleeping, just like a regular bed, especially if the bed mattress is comfortable.
3. What mattress size do I need for the trundle bed?
The trundle usually accommodates a twin-size bed mattress, however constantly examine the requirements of your particular bed design.
4. Just how much weight can a bunk bed with a trundle hold?
This varies by design, so it's essential to check the producer's specs regarding weight limits for both levels.
5. Do bunk beds with rotates require unique bed mattress?
No special mattresses are required; a regular twin mattress typically fits, however it's crucial to check the maker's suggestions.
